What Is Average Speed?
Understanding the Context
Average speed is a straightforward calculation that defines how fast an object has traveled over a given period. It tells you the overall rate of motion, independent of speed variations during the journey. The formula is simple:
Average Speed = Total Distance Traveled ÷ Total Time Taken
For example, if you drive 150 miles in 3 hours, your average speed is:
150 miles ÷ 3 hours = 50 miles per hour (mph)
Key Insights
This means, on average, you were moving at 50 mph throughout the trip—even if your speed changed due to traffic, rest stops, or highway driving.
Why Is This Formula Important?
Knowing the relationship between distance, time, and speed helps in real-life applications such as:
- Estimating travel time on road trips
- Evaluating vehicle performance and fuel efficiency
- Planning exercise routines for runners or cyclists
- Interpreting speed data from GPS and dash cams
Rather than fixating on momentary speeds, average speed provides clarity and consistency in assessing journey efficiency.

Practical Example: Driving 150 Miles in 3 Hours
Imagine driving from City A to City B, covering a distance of 150 miles. If the trip starts at 9:00 AM and concludes at 12:00 PM, the total time is 3 hours.
Using the formula:
150 miles ÷ 3 hours = 50 mph
This tells us the driver maintained an average speed of 50 mph the entire way. This consistent pace might result from steady highway driving with minimal stops. However, if there were congestion or breaks, average speed smooths out speed fluctuations.
Tips for Accurate Speed Measurements
- Use precise timers and distance meters (e.g., GPS apps or odometers).
- Avoid rounding errors—perform calculations with exact figures.
- Consider partial trips or daily commutes where average speed reveals commuting efficiency.
